Delta Air Lines Fuels CES 2026 with Unprecedented Las Vegas Connectivity

Delta Air Lines is set to be the dominant force in air travel for CES 2026, dramatically enhancing connectivity to Las Vegas from key U.S. hubs and crucial international technology centers. The airline has announced an ambitious plan to operate over 700 direct flights into McCarran International Airport (LAS) during the highly anticipated consumer electronics show. This move underscores Delta’s commitment to facilitating seamless travel for attendees and exhibitors alike, positioning itself as the go-to carrier for one of the world’s most significant technology gatherings.

Strategic Network Expansion for CES 2026

The extensive flight schedule is meticulously designed to serve a broad spectrum of travelers. Delta is reinforcing its presence from major U.S. domestic gateways, ensuring easy access for a vast majority of American tech professionals and enthusiasts. Simultaneously, the airline is prioritizing direct routes from leading international cities renowned for their innovation and technological prowess. This includes significant boosts to service from established tech capitals and emerging innovation hubs, recognizing the global nature of the consumer electronics industry.

By offering more than 700 direct flights, Delta aims to mitigate the logistical challenges often associated with large-scale events like CES. This increased capacity directly addresses potential issues such as flight availability, pricing fluctuations, and the need for efficient travel solutions. Attendees can expect a wider range of departure and arrival times, providing greater flexibility to plan their schedules around the exhibition and its numerous networking opportunities.
